Cost of Living on a Superyacht

Living on a superyacht is often seen as the ultimate luxury lifestyle, but it can also be an expensive one.

The cost of living on a superyacht varies widely depending on the size and amenities of the vessel, as well as the duration of the charter.

For a basic model, the cost of chartering a superyacht for a week can range from $10,000 to $50,000, while a larger vessel with more amenities can cost upwards of $200,000 per week.

For those who plan to live on a superyacht long-term, the cost of berthing and maintaining the vessel can add up quickly.

In addition to the cost of chartering or owning the vessel, there are other expenses associated with living on a superyacht, such as fuel, food, and crew salaries.

All of these factors must be taken into account when deciding whether living on a superyacht is a feasible and affordable option.

Challenges of Living on a Superyacht

Living on a superyacht may be a dream for many, but with it comes a unique set of challenges.

For starters, space is often limited on a superyacht.

This means that the living quarters can be cramped and there may not be enough room for all of one’s belongings.

Additionally, the remote and often isolated locations that many superyachts travel to can limit access to amenities such as grocery stores and other necessities.

Finally, living on a superyacht can be expensive.

Chartering a superyacht can be costly, and the cost of maintenance, fuel, and crew can add up quickly.

Security is another issue to consider when living on a superyacht.

Because many superyachts are in remote and often isolated locations, there may be limited or no access to law enforcement if there is an emergency.

Additionally, there may be limited access to medical care, which could be a problem if someone were to become ill or injured while on board.

Finally, the weather can present a challenge for those living on a superyacht.

Because superyachts travel to many different destinations, they may be exposed to rough seas, high winds, and other unpredictable weather patterns.

This can be dangerous for those on board, and can also put a strain on the vessel if the weather is too severe.
